Our Admiral freezer door kept popping open. We called the warranty phone number in our manual and the CSR said it was probably the gasket - although the refrigerator is less than 2 years old. She said the service call would be $65 and she could have a tech out the next day. A&E Factory Service handles the service calls for Admiral.

When the tech arrived he could not duplicate the problem and thought that the drawer in the bottom of the freezer might be causing the problem. (Apparently it was sitting out ever so slightly.) His diagnosis on the invoice is "unable to duplicate complaint" and he charged us $91.20.

When I called the local office to find out why the charge was so much more than we were quoted, I was told that we had to pay for labor. I asked how we could be charged a labor charge when the diagnosis was "unable to duplicate complaint" and the tech did not do any diagnostic or repair work? I was told that pushing in the drawer was considered labor and that the diagnostic code determined the charge, therefore, I was not overcharged.

I spoke with Brenda in the local office, who claimed to be a supervisor. She refused a credit and hung up on me.
